Fothergill Hall Seating Refurbishment
Help us modernise the Fothergill Hall, Ackworth’s iconic theatre and performance space. We launched this development project on our 246th Founders Day, 18th October 2025, the day that commemorates John Fothergill’s vision in opening the school. We will replace the 222 seats (16 rows × 14) with modern, comfortable tip-up seating and invite Old Scholars, parents, staff, and friends to sponsor a seat. If we exceed our fundraising target, we can consider additional improvements such as electronic blinds, framed posters and photographs from our archive of performances covering the last 125 years.

A brief history
Originally, the Girls’ Dining Room served as a lecture hall, but overcrowding meant a new venue was needed. At Ackworth General Meeting in 1898, Joseph Whitwell Pease laid the foundation stone of the new Fothergill Hall. The following year, Henry Thompson formally opened it, introduced by the Headmaster, Frederick Andrews, as ‘scholar, apprentice, master and committee man’. Henry Thompson was also the author of the definitive History of Ackworth School that covered the history of the school’s first hundred years.
